<br /> <br /> <br />South end of Site C Mine Site <br />Due to similar slopes, aspect, vegetation, and soils for Site C, <br />Samples 2, 3 and 4; and to increase sampling point significance, the data <br />have been combined to provide an "average vegetation type" quantitative <br />estimate. Shrubs dominate the composition at 50.0$, followed by Forbs 22$ <br />and Grass 28.0. Bare ground accounted for 73~ of the sampling areas with <br />9.5$ litter cover. Shrubs provide 8.5~ total cover, Grass 5~ and Forbs 4$. <br />An important component of these sample sites has been vegetative <br />litter. While the sparse vegetation is readily apparent, the litter is not <br />as obvious and should be carefully considered in re-vegetation efforts. <br /> Intercept Percent <br />Species Points Count <br />Chrysothamnus vicidiflorus 7 6.5 <br />Eurotia Janata 2 2.0 <br />Abronia fragrans 2 2.0 <br />Eriogonum loncophyllum 1 1.0 <br />Lepidium montanum 1 1.0 <br />Oryzopsis hymenoides 5 5.0 <br />Litter 10 9.5 <br />Bare ground 77 73.0 <br />Total 105 100 <br />(continued on page 13) <br />-12- <br />
